Spring启动数据库应用程序

时间:2018-03-08 17:22:09

标签: spring spring-mvc spring-boot

我正在使用一些视频教程来处理该项目。 https://www.youtube.com/watch?time_continue=851&v=lpcOSXWPXTk TopicService类中的作者在方法内使用findOne()修改和删除而不为它们创建方法。当我一步一步地做同样的事情时,我无法做到,任何想法为什么?我正在扩展CrudRepository,显然这个repo给你这个访问findOne并删除co​​mmends.When我试图建立项目并转到http://localhost:8080/topics

Whitelabel Error Page
This application has no explicit mapping for /error, so you are seeing 
this as a fallback.

Thu Mar 08 17:16:37 GMT 2018
There was an unexpected error (type=Not Found, status=404).
No message available

https://github.com/exovsky/wepappproblem<<我在这里上传

感谢您的帮助

2 个答案:

答案 0 :(得分:0)

试试这个......

首先,这必须是您的项目结构:

project-structure

第二步将@Repository注释添加到TopicRepository类,删除添加的方法,然后替换

第三步修改TopicService类的代码,如下所示:

<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<select>
    <option value="">Menu</option>
    <option value="11">Item 1</option>
    <option value="22">Item 2</option>
</select>

一个推荐,你不需要提交目标文件夹,你必须忽略它。

答案 1 :(得分:0)

您的@SpringBootApplication位置错误。 将WebapproflApplication.class放入java / com或添加自定义@ComponentScan

请参阅此处:https://docs.spring.io/spring-boot/docs/current/reference/html/using-boot-structuring-your-code.html#using-boot-locating-the-main-class

相关问题